Technology solutions help community financial institutions manage risk and support growth. These solutions automate key processes, including anti-money laundering, fraud detection, CECL readiness, and lending workflows, addressing Enterprise Risk Management needs efficiently.
About the Role
This role is suited for a skilled Salesforce Administrator who takes pride in their work and values a strong company culture. The position focuses on maintaining and improving the Salesforce environment, ensuring its features meet the needs of different user groups. Collaboration with internal stakeholders is a key part of this role to understand requirements and enhance the system accordingly. Responsibilities include user support, customization, training, and encouraging system adoption. Day-to-day tasks include adding or removing users, managing workflows, and performing system audits.
Responsibilities
- Serve as a Salesforce.com system administrator
- Handle basic administrative tasks, including user account maintenance, reports, dashboards, and workflows
- Conduct regular system audits and manage upgrades
- Oversee Salesforce.com data feeds and integrations
- Evaluate, scope, and complete new development requests
- Work with institutional management to establish support processes for system administration, development, and change management
- Train new users and support Salesforce skill development across the organization
- Act as the liaison between users, vendors, and the application development team
- Independently gather and document development requirements from stakeholders
